Pasta pudding with sheep cheese
Delicious Penne Pudding with Sheep Cheese
If you're looking for a quick and tasty dessert recipe that combines the perfect texture of pasta with the unmistakable flavor of sheep cheese, you've come to the right place! This pudding with penne and sheep cheese is an excellent choice for a family meal or a gathering with friends. It will delight you not only with its aroma but also with its ease of preparation.
Preparation time: 15 minutes
Baking time: 45 minutes
Total time: 1 hour
Number of servings: 6
Ingredients
- 500 g penne
- 600 g sheep cheese
- 5 eggs
- 100 g sour cream
- 100 ml milk
- 50 g butter (for greasing the dish)
- 50 g grated parmesan
- Freshly ground pepper (to taste)

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Preparing the Pasta: In a large pot, bring water to a boil and add salt. Cook the penne pasta according to the package instructions, usually between 8-10 minutes, until al dente. Remember to st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
2. Preparing the Cheese: While the pasta is boiling, take a fork and crumble the sheep cheese in a large bowl. You can also grate it, but the fork method will add a more rustic texture.
3. Egg Mixture: Add the 5 eggs to the bowl with the cheese, followed by the sour cream and milk. Mix well with a whisk or fork until you achieve a homogeneous composition. Season with pepper to taste. It’s important to check the flavor, and if the cheese is already salty, there’s no need to add extra salt.
4. Cooling the Pasta: Once the pasta is cooked, drain it well under cold running water to stop the cooking process. Let it drain for a few minutes.
5. Combining Ingredients: Add the drained pasta to the bowl with the cheese and egg mixture. Use a spatula or large spoon to mix everything until the pasta is evenly coated with the creamy mixture.
6. Preparing the Baking Dish: Preheat the oven to 180°C. Grease a baking dish with butter to prevent sticking. You can use a ceramic or heat-resistant glass dish.
7. Pouring the Mixture: Pour the pasta mixture into the prepared dish, leveling it with a spatula.
8. Adding the Parmesan: Grate the parmesan and mix it with one egg. This mix will create a delicious crust on top. Evenly sprinkle the parmesan mixture over the pudding in the dish.
9. Baking: Place the dish in the preheated oven and let it bake for about 45 minutes, or until the pudding has a golden crust and is well set. You can check the consistency with a toothpick; if it comes out clean, the pudding is done.
10. Serving: Let the pudding cool for 10-15 minutes before cutting it. You can serve it warm alongside a fresh salad, or cold as a delicious appetizer.
Variations and Suggestions
- Additions: You can add vegetables such as spinach or zucchini for extra nutrients and color.
- Cheese: Substitute sheep cheese with feta or mozzarella for a different taste experience.
- Spices: Experiment with herbs like oregano or basil to add a Mediterranean touch.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I use whole grain pasta? Yes, whole grain pasta will provide extra fiber and nutrients while still being tasty.
2. What other cheeses can I use? You can opt for goat cheese, ricotta, or even cheddar, depending on your preferences.
3. How can I store the pudding? This pudding keeps well in the refrigerator, covered, for 2-3 days. You can reheat it in the microwave or oven.
